About Patrick Sharp
Patrick Sharp is a scholar working on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, Small Animals, Surgery, Genetics and Physiology, having authored 40 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Veterinary Pharmacology and Anesthesia (9 papers), Growth Hormone and Insulin-like Growth Factors (8 papers), Diabetes Management and Research (7 papers), Diabetes and associated disorders (6 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(5 papers), Diet and metabolism studies (4 papers), Metabolism, Diabetes, and Cancer (3 papers) and Antibiotics Pharmacokinetics and Efficacy (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(444 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(220 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(210 citations), Clinical Biochemistry (43 citations) and Physiology (146 citations). Patrick Sharp has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Thailand. Frequent co-authors include Desmond G. Johnston, Salem Beshyah, Roger Corder, Leslee J. Shaw, David Hopkins, Avijit Lahiri, David Lipkin, Dhakshinamurthy Vijay Anand, Eric Lim and Rodney A. Foale.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American Association for Laboratory Animal Science, Clinical Endocrinology, Animals, Diabetes Care and European Journal of Endocrinology.
